However, there’s no getting away from the fact that bangs … Web08. apr 2024. · Hold your hair dryer over your head, facing down toward your forehead, and brush your bangs from side to side until dry. This takes care of any cowlicks and ensures your bangs fall straight. Finish by rolling the ends under. 03 of 08 Invest in a Tiny Flat Iron To tame frizz and seal the shape, finish by smoothing your bangs with a flat iron.
